Thomas Stanley

[edit]

I have removed this "The author Thomas Stanley was born in Clothall in 1625 and is buried in the church.[1]" because he was born in Cumberlow, which may have been in the parish of Rushden or Clothall, but certainly not in the village, and he was buried at St Martin-in-the-Fields. AnemoneProjectors 19:43, 9 March 2016 (UTC)Reply

Now reinstated but with better sources - although Cumberlow Green today is mostly in Rushden parish, the former manor house of Cumberlow was unambiguously in Clothall parish. This article is also about both the village and parish. Stortford (talk) 07:49, 5 May 2025 (UTC)Reply
